
body {
background-color: #400000;
background-image: url('bg-x.jpg');
background-repeat: repeat-x;
font: 7.5pt Century Gothic;
color: #FF8888;
line-height: 10pt;
padding: 0px;
margin: 0px;
}

.kiro-hisa {
font: 7.5pt Century Gothic;
color: #000000;
line-height: 10pt;
background-color: ;
background-image: url('div-bg.jpg');
border-left: 10px solid #880000;
border-right: 10px solid #a20014;
text-align: justify;
padding-left: 5px;
padding: 5px;
margin-top: -11px;
}

h1 {
font-family: Century Gothic;
font-size: 25pt;
color: #CC0000;
line-height: 25pt;
border-right: 100px solid #C10000;
font-style: oblique;
text-align: left;
text-transform: lowercase;
padding: 2px;
margin-bottom: 12px;
}

h2 {
font-family: Century Gothic;
font-size: 14pt;
color: #FF3333;
line-height: 16pt;
border-bottom: 1px dashed #FF6666;
text-align: center;
text-transform: lowercase;
padding: 1px;
margin-bottom: 3px;
}

a.kaname:link, a.kaname:visited, a.kaname:active {
display: block;
font: 7pt Century Gothic;
color: #FF4E52;
background-color: #970004;
border-bottom: 1px solid #EE4A0D;
text-align: left;
text-transform: uppercase;
letter-spacing: 0.5em;
text-decoration: none;
padding-right: 10px;
padding: 1px;
margin: 0px;
}

a.kaname:hover {
display: block;
font: 7pt Century Gothic;
color: #970004;
background-color: #EE4A0D;
border-bottom: 1px solid #CC00FF;
text-align: left;
text-transform: uppercase;
letter-spacing: 0.5em;
text-decoration: none;
padding-right: 10px;
padding: 1px;
margin: 0px;
}

b, strong {
color: #FFCC00;
}

i, em {
color: #003300;
}

u {
color: #820021;
border-bottom: 1px solid #75001E;
text-decoration: none;
}

s, strike {
color: #C9C9C9;
}

a:link, a:visited, a:active {
color: #FF4E52;
background-color: #970004;
text-transform: uppercase;
text-decoration: none;
}

a:hover {
color: #970004;
background-color: #EE4A0D;
text-transform: uppercase;
text-decoration: none;
}

#souichirou {
position: absolute;
width: 490px;
height: 350px;
left: 3px;
top: 560px;
}

#masato {
position: absolute;
width: 160px;
height: 350px;
left: 510px;
top: 560px;
}
